    # This is a FOX version of Thomas and Hunt's timeless classic,
    # the Pig It! example (from the "Ruby/Tk" chapter of "Programming
    # Ruby".
    #
    
    require 'fox16'
    
    include Fox
    
    class PigBox < FXMainWindow
      def pig(word)
        leadingCap = word =~ /^A-Z/
        word.downcase!
        res = case word
          when /^aeiouy/
            word+"way"
          when /^([^aeiouy]+)(.*)/
            $2+$1+"ay"
          else
            word
        end
        leadingCap ? res.capitalize : res
      end
    
      def showPig
        @text.value = @text.value.split.collect{|w| pig(w)}.join(" ")
      end
    
      def initialize(app)
        # Initialize base class
        super(app, "Pig")
        
        @text = FXDataTarget.new("")
        
        top = FXVerticalFrame.new(self, LAYOUT_FILL_X|LAYOUT_FILL_Y) do |theFrame|
          theFrame.padLeft = 10
          theFrame.padRight = 10
          theFrame.padBottom = 10
          theFrame.padTop = 10
          theFrame.vSpacing = 20
        end
        
        p = proc { showPig }
        
        FXLabel.new(top, 'Enter Text:') do |theLabel|
          theLabel.layoutHints = LAYOUT_FILL_X
        end
        
        FXTextField.new(top, 20, @text, FXDataTarget::ID_VALUE) do |theTextField|
          theTextField.layoutHints = LAYOUT_FILL_X
          theTextField.setFocus()
        end
        
        FXButton.new(top, 'Pig It') do |pigButton|
          pigButton.connect(SEL_COMMAND, p)
          pigButton.layoutHints = LAYOUT_CENTER_X
        end
        
        FXButton.new(top, 'Exit') do |exitButton|
          exitButton.connect(SEL_COMMAND) { exit }
          exitButton.layoutHints = LAYOUT_CENTER_X
        end
      end
      
      def create
        super
        show(PLACEMENT_SCREEN)
      end
    end
    
    if __FILE__ == $0
      app = FXApp.new("Pig It", "FXRuby")
      PigBox.new(app)
      app.create
      app.run
    end
